There's lots of colors and numbers to Tamiya's shock damper oils, but what do they mean and when should they be used? I'm this episode of the RC Deep Dive we review the following choices: Red 200, Orange 300, Yellow 400, Green 500, Blue 600, Purple 700, Pink 800, White 900, & Light Blue 1000.

A popular Hop-Up for vintage R/C buggies like the Frog, Grasshopper, and Hornet is using Subaru BRAT Wheels and tires. Why is this? Is it a good option? And how do you get them to fit your radio controlled cars, trucks, and buggies? We find out on this episode of the RC Deep Dive!
